#1357. Wild Things Mask

Art, level: Pre-School
Posted Wed Oct 20 13:08:25 PDT 1999 by teresa ().
Materials Required: large paper plates,feathers,glitter,pom-poms(small),clothepins,school glue
Activity Time: 30 minutes with a class of 12-15

cut out 2 quarter size eyes. Have children glue on the paper plate and put on all the little items listed in the materials needed. They can also use crayons to color on the paper plate. They can arrange the items wherever they would like to put them. Lastly put a dab of glue on the bottom of the paper plate and have the child clip the clothepin on, this will be what they hold their plate up with when it all dries.
